addon-sdk/source/README
author Karl Tomlinson <karlt+@karlt.net>
Wed, 02 Jul 2014 20:22:45 +1200
changeset 192471 0f1cea1a1a952c84d2a5758dbf9efc3ee6fe5dfc
parent 174620 a41aa11204347a7675bf15b566eab0d1fabec710
child 223296 182904efdc21a48b08d55f78154ae7afe2033a22
permissions -rw-r--r--
b=1033140 make speex_resampler declarations consistent with OUTSIDE_SPEEX implementation r=padenot Instead of defining OUTSIDE_SPEEX and RANDOM_PREFIX everywhere speex_resampler.h is included, it is easier to patch the header. Symbol names in gkmedias symbols.def are updated now that RANDOM_PREFIX is taking effect, and unused symbols are no longer exported.

Add-on SDK README
==================

Before proceeding, please make sure you've installed Python 2.5,
2.6, or 2.7 (if it's not already on your system):

  http://python.org/download/

Note that Python 3 is not supported.

For Windows users, MozillaBuild (https://wiki.mozilla.org/MozillaBuild)
will install the correct version of Python and the MSYS package, which
will make it easier to work with the SDK.

To get started, first enter the same directory that this README file
is in (the SDK's root directory) using a shell program. On Unix systems
or on Windows with MSYS, you can execute the following command:

  source bin/activate

Windows users using cmd.exe should instead run:

  bin\activate.bat

Then go to https://developer.mozilla.org/en-US/Add-ons/SDK/
to browse the SDK documentation.

If you get an error when running cfx or have any other problems getting
started, see the "Troubleshooting" guide at:
https://developer.mozilla.org/en-US/Add-ons/SDK/Tutorials/Troubleshooting

Bugs
-------

* file a bug: https://bugzilla.mozilla.org/enter_bug.cgi?product=Add-on%20SDK


Style Guidelines
--------------------

* https://github.com/mozilla/addon-sdk/wiki/Coding-style-guide